Overview
This quaint 200 year old cottage, hidden away down a tree-lined driveway, offers a very peaceful base for touring the beautiful coastline and rolling countryside of Wexford. Its traditional features include thick stone walls, stone floors, and interconnecting rooms. (The steep open tread staircase is unsuitable for infirm). Set amongst 45 acres of forest yet only 5 miles from Wexford Town, the vibrant regional centre with its interesting mix of shops and restaurants. (Property 4397 is next door ideal for a couple).
